Sushi Zanmai @ One Utama

Hello peeps, how have you been? Just got back from my trip to Singapore.. Feeling so refreshed now, except for my overused leg muscles! =.=

Anyway, here's another food post again.. And as the title says, I'll be writing about Sushi today! So my first question is, which is your favorite sushi place? So far I have tried Sushi King, Sakae Sushi, Sushi Zanmai, Shogun, Tenji 2, Maiu and etc..


One of my most favorite so far is Sushi Zanmai..



The price of their main dishes are rather reasonable.. Say for example,


Both the Chicken Karaage Don (on the left) and Tendon (on the right) cost RM8.80 (small) and RM15.80 (large). 
One thing about the portion though, small is really enough unless you are a extreme big eater.. =)

Then they have this belt the runs sushi around their restaurant for us to pick and choose..



If you somehow think that those on the belt are not freshly prepared, or if you think that you'd prefer some of the sushi in the menu that are not available at the belt, you can always make an order.. And that's what we did..


From the left, Salmon Peach RM 3.80, Tai RM 4.80 and Ajitsuke Shiitake RM1.80.. Didn't think the Tai had a much different taste then normal Salmon.. But then its probably because I tried the sushi instead of the thick slab of flesh, sashimi! ugh.. talking about sashimi.. I sure miss that.. XD


Close up picture of peach salmon


Sauce for the sushi! Oh btw, something which is utterly non-important, you know previously they liked placing wasabi on the belt and you have to get it from the belt, take the amount you want and then put it back onto the belt for other people to eat? Well, the last time I went to Sushi Zanmai, there was wasabi on our desk and was no longer seen on the belt! Not that its important, just so you know.. =P


We also ordered this Salmon to Avocado Roll RM12.80.. This tasted heavenly! Didn't think avocado would go so well as a topping for rolls! Be sure to try it!

Overall, a me gusta meal.. hehe..

Moo Cow versus Tutti Fruiti

Two frozen yogurt (froyo) that I have fallen in love with.. So who's the winner? Take a look:

p/s: for those lazy to read this long ass post, do scroll right to the bottom for my conclusion..

My first time trying froyo was with Tutti Frutti near Sunway Giza.. First impression was RM0.53/10g?! OUCH!! Second thought that hit me was, "wow, self-service? Great! I can control the amount so that my budget won't run!" *evil grin*

In the end, I took 1.5 twist as shown in the right bottom picture and was happily going to pay when I saw my friend filling her cup with all sorts of toppings (the yogurt on the bottom left is hers) and due to peer pressure, I added some fruits as well.. kiwi, mango and a strawberry.. And when it was time to pay, mine cost RM16.90, my friend's cost RM23.90 and the other yogurt on the top right corner cost RM10.90.. And then I realized my mistake.. Fruits are damn heavy and not worth RM0.53/10g!!! FML!! I am so stupid!


Oh well, what's done is done.. Took a bite and realized OMG! My new found love!! You know how people say yogurt is healthy and ice-cream is fattening? This is like healthy ice-cream! Cold, sweet and yummy! And the fruits.. wtf? its so fresh and juicy..

And then, not long ago, I found Moo Cow froyo.. A promoter tried giving me some sample and I was like, "seriously? You Tutti Frutti imitator?" But being greedy, I took the sample and tried.. And OMG!!! It was so awesome!! The milky taste is so out of the world!  The price is also quite reasonable at RM9.90 + 1 free topping for original flavour and RM10.90 for other flavours + RM1 for extra toppings..


 Difference between Moo Cow and Tutti Fruitti:
1) Moo Cow has a very much more milky taste as compared to Tutti Frutti..
2) Tutti Frutti has a way wider selection of froyo choices as well as topping choices
3) Moo Cow has healthier topping choices such as blackcurrant, cereal and etc..
4) Tutti Frutti is a do-it-yourself kinda thing while Moo Cow isn't..
5) Price? I'd go with Moo Cow is cheaper..

Overall, my preference is Moo Cow because I am a sucker for that milky taste as well as the price range..What about you? xoxo

Departure Lounge @ Uptown, Petaling Jaya

I recently went to a place called the Departure Lounge at Uptown, Petaling Jaya. A friend introduced me there. I thought it sounded kinda weird. Why Departure right? Why not arrival?? Is like people who comes to your place are going to leave soon..

Anyway, when I got there, I realised that the place was actually decorated in such a way it looked like the departure lounge in the airport.. ahhh.. so therefore the name.. I did not do a good job with taking pictures at the interior designs this time because I was busy chatting with my friends.. Sorry about that, anyhow, I do have some food pictures to show you..


From the left, the first and third picture is the "Do It My Way Breakfast". You get to pick the 3-items, 5-items and 7-items platter which cost RM8.90, RM11.90 and RM13.90 respectively. The second picture is a ham and cheese sandwich while the fourth one is a Departure Lounge special. I can't really remember the price. But the range is there around the 7-item platter. But I'd say not too cheap if you are looking for just a simple breakfast. It is worth a try though..


Address:
No. 10, Jalan SS21/39,
Damansara Utama,
47400 Petaling Jaya,
Malaysia


Phone No.: 03-77251682


Opening Hours:
Mon-Sat, 8am-7pm
Sun & Public Holidays, 8am-5pm
Closed on Tuesdays & major holidays.
